Mount Washington

"Mount Washington (formerly Agiocochook), at 6,288 ft. (1916.6 m), is the highest peak in the American Northeast. It is famous for its dangerously erratic weather, holding the record for the highest wind gust directly measured at the Earth's surface, at 231 mph (372 km/h) on the afternoon of April 12, 1934. "

Fort Constitution

"In the American Revolution, the fort witnessed the first act of open rebellion in New Hampshire and the first overt act of the Revolution anywhere in the United States. "
